Holy God,
in silence my soul
waits for you, for you alone.
It does not wait to test you,
nor for wonders and signs,
but only for your light
to shine in my
darkness.

Selected Verses
Ps. 62:1
For God alone my soul waits in silence;
from him comes my salvation.
Judges 6:36-37
Then Gideon said to God, “In order to see whether you will deliver Israel by my hand, as you have said, I am going to lay a fleece of wool on the threshing floor; if there is dew on the fleece alone, and it is dry on all the ground, then I shall know that you will deliver Israel by my hand, as you have said.”
Acts 2:43
Awe came upon everyone, because many wonders and signs were being done by the apostles.
John 1:5
The light shines in the darkness, and the darkness did not overcome it.
